December 31, 1938 – August 21, 2025
Gary Peter Olson, age 86, of Otsego, MN, passed away peacefully at home on August 21, 2025, with his beloved wife, Cindy, by his side.
Gary was born in Fargo, ND, on December 31, 1938, and was adopted by Lloyd and Elizabeth (Westad) Olson at the age of 22 months. He attended schools in Esmond and Rich Valley Township, graduating from high school in Maddock in 1956. After graduation, he worked on the family farm for four years. During that time, he was a custom sheep shearer with his cousin, Gene, for several seasons.
In February 1960, he joined the U.S. Army and served in the paratroops. He was selected as Soldier of the Month for January 1961, representing approximately 700 men of the 101st Airborne Division Artillery at Fort Campbell, Kentucky.
He later attended and graduated from Valley City State College, then taught mathematics in Milwaukee, WI, for five years before spending a year and summer at NDSU in Fargo, ND. He went on to teach at several high schools in the Osseo, MN, school district for 30 years until his retirement in 2000. Beginning in 1991, he also taught part time at North Hennepin Community College in Brooklyn Park, MN, and after 2000, continued part and full time until December 2010.
In 1979, he married Julie Pearson, and with this marriage came Karen Booth. Together they had two sons: Mike and Eric. They later divorced. In 1993, he married Cindy Lee Walsh, and with this marriage came Jared Walsh.
Gary was an avid genealogist, researching and compiling over 163,000 names of relatives, living and deceased, from Norway, Sweden, Denmark, and the United States.
